For almost every mental/health condition, there are a number of effective treatments that can help a veteran cope with symptoms and greatly improve their quality of life. A. The diagnosis of post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D) is made only when very specific criteria are met. One person who has been diagnosed with PTSD may look very different from another with the same disorder. The specific traumatic experience and the resultant impact on the individual and his/her loved ones are unique to each family. (how people can get on… Achilles in Vietnam: Combat Trauma and the Undoing of Character Jonathan Shay. And considers the ways in which societies ancient and modern have accounted for and dealt with post-traumatic stress disorder -a malady only recently recognized in the medical literature, but well attested in Homer's pages.
